WebDenyse Thomasos. Trinidadian, Canadian Port of Spain, Trinidad and Tobago, 1964 New York, United States, 2012. Denyse Thomasos was an award-winning painter who lived in Toronto and later, in New York City. Her work was informed by her extensive international travels and her study of the effects of oppressive systems on the African diaspora. WebJan 28, 2024 · Thomasos was born in Trinidad and grew up in Toronto; in 1983, she began her studies in the joint Sheridan College and University of Toronto Mississauga Art and Art History Program, graduating in 1987. Thomasos lived and worked in the East Village, New York City with her husband and daughter. She is represented by Lennon, Weinberg …

WebDenyse Thomasos is best known for her large-scale, semi-abstract paintings. Her work often references architecture and structural elements as a means of discussing themes as varied as slavery, mass incarceration, immigration, and urban life. Many of the colours and motifs in her pieces are inspired by non-Western societies, specifically those in West Africa, India, …
WebArnold Thomasos. Clytus Arnold Thomasos is arguably Arima’s most distinguished son. He was born on July 23rd, 1906, the son of Ceran Thomasos and Eudora, popularly known as Tantie Dodo. He attended the Arima Boys’ R.C. School following which he entered the Pupil Teacher system. He spent 35 years of his life in the service of education.
